At the facility of melamine's significance is its chemical framework and the buildings that result from it. Melamine is a triazine compound understood for high nitrogen web content, which aids improve fire resistance in certain solutions. When integrated with resins and treated right into solid materials, it adds solidity, scrape resistance, and thermal stability. These characteristics make melamine specifically useful in products that should hold up against constant handling, cleansing, or exposure to elevated temperature levels. Kitchen counters, cupboards, crockery, ornamental laminates, and commercial layers all gain from the performance account melamine can aid offer.

In mix with formaldehyde-based chemistry, melamine aids create resilient thermosetting resins made use of in surface coverings and shaped write-ups. Melamine is also beneficial in attractive laminates, where appearance and efficiency have to exist side-by-side. Melamine resin is commonly made use of as a surface area layer in these products because it treatments into a difficult, steady surface.

Coatings are an additional major application area. Melamine resins are regularly utilized in vehicle, appliance, and industrial coverings due to the fact that they add hardness, gloss retention, and chemical resistance. When baked or treated under the ideal problems, these layers form a crosslinked surface area that can better stand up to wear and environmental tension. This is particularly beneficial for products revealed to repeated cleaning or modest warm. In some systems, melamine is utilized as a crosslinking representative that reacts with other resin elements to develop an extra durable last movie. The outcome is often a coating with improved longevity and an extra sleek surface.
